LOCATE.UPDATEDB(8) System Manager's Manual LOCATE.UPDATEDB(8) NAME locate.updatedb – update locate database SYNOPSIS /usr/libexec/locate.updatedb DESCRIPTION The locate.updatedb utility updates the database used by locate(1). It is typically run once a week by the /System/Library/LaunchDaemons/com.apple.locate.plist job. The contents of the newly built database can be controlled by the /etc/locate.rc file. ENVIRONMENT LOCATE_CONFIG path to the configuration file FILES /var/db/locate.database the default database /etc/locate.rc the configuration file SEE ALSO locate(1), launchd(8) Woods, James A., “Finding Files Fast”, ;login, 8:1, pp. 8-10, 1983. macOS 15.2 February 11, 1996 macOS 15.2
